For this card I used the “Make a Wish” stamp set, which I stamped with Versamark ink and heat embossed with white embossing powder. Then I used “Picked Raspberries” and Peacock Feathers” Distress Ink to water color the background. I really like the water color effect of Distress Ink by Ranger. I placed the water colored piece on a card base made with Bazzil Marshmallow cardstock and I framed using the “Framed Tags Creative Cuts”
I used couple of puppies from “Playful Pups” stamp and die set, and the party hats from the “Carnival Toppers” stamp and die set, I colored them very simply, using Copic Markers: T0, T2, T4, BG18, BG 15, BG13.
